Sally Helgesen was genuinely ahead of her time identifying the collapse of work-life boundaries in networked economies, and the six-strategy framework earned endorsements from Stephen Covey and Tom Peters for good reason. Published in 2001, though, it predates smartphones, remote work, and the pandemic's permanent reshaping of working life β€” readers today will need to mentally translate heavily, and newer books on the same terrain have had two more decades of evidence to draw from.
